Details and patient eligibility

About

This study is to compare the clinical outcome between the biportal endoscopic decompression and the unilateral approach bilateral decompression in spinal stenosis

Enrollment

64 patients

Sex

All

Ages

30 to 80 years old

Volunteers

No Healthy Volunteers

Inclusion criteria

  • patients aged between 30 and 80
  • patients who has radiating pain (VAS >=40) on lower extremities with spinal stenosis over Gr B
  • patients who required one-level decompression between L1 and S1
  • those who (only if a signature was obtainable), or whose legal guardian, fully understood the clinical trial details and signed the informed consent form

Exclusion criteria

  • Revision surgery
  • Over spondylolisthesis Gr II
  • Degenerative lumbar scoliosis (Cobb angle >20)
  • herniated disc
  • patients with a history of other spinal diseases (compression fracture, spondylitis, tumor)
  • women with positive pregnancy tests before the trial or who planned to become pregnant within the following 3 years
  • patients with a history of malignant tumor or malignant diseases (but the cases of cured disease with no relapse for the past 5 years were included in the present study)
  • patients with mental retardation or whose parents or legal guardians were older or had mental disabilities
  • other patients viewed as inappropriate by the staff
